One of the key aspects of A level psychology is understanding the different approaches to psychology. These approaches include biological, cognitive, behavioral, psychodynamic, and humanistic perspectives, each offering a unique lens through which to view human behavior. Students will learn about the various theories and concepts associated with each approach and evaluate their strengths and limitations. They will also explore how these approaches can be applied to real-world situations and understand the implications they have on society as a whole.
Another important aspect of A level psychology is the study of research methods. Students will learn about the different research designs, data collection techniques, and statistical analysis methods used in psychological research. They will also learn how to conduct their own experiments, gather data, and draw conclusions based on their findings. This hands-on approach to learning allows students to apply their theoretical knowledge to practical situations and develop valuable research skills that are essential for success in the field of psychology.
In addition to understanding the different approaches to psychology and research methods, students studying A level psychology will also explore a wide range of topics within the field. These topics may include social influence, memory, abnormal behavior, cognitive development, and many more. By studying these topics, students will gain a comprehensive understanding of the various aspects of human behavior and the factors that influence our thoughts, feelings, and actions.
